THE GARDEN

Abubakkar a man in his late 30's, short, slightly bald at the centre which he thinks is inherited by its not, looks fat not not too fat only at belly and at hands, woke up by his alarm.

He walks with a bucket out looking above at the tiny houses like his. He always feels seeing the beehive of houses that he is living inside the belly of a mammoth.

Stands in a queue outside of the bathroom talking with his neighbour's mostly his age or more. They talk about politics, news, mostly will be about gossips about ladies and relationships.

On his turn he walks in, cleans out his body and mind.

Walks out, stands in another queue, fills the bucket with dripping water from the tap. Takes bath near it.

Walks back to his house, seeing his wife Shaja preparing food. He hugs her. She pushes him in shy pointing at the sleeping child.

He jumps in bed waking his only, loving daughter alia. Fights with her, gives her a rose saying it was a gift from the plants. She hugs him with love.

He puts down the mat. Stands on it. Raises his hand to his ears say “Allahu Akbar”. On his each position, at start he says ‘Allahu Akbar”, then at being in that position he prays with the words of god.

After praying for 5 minutes he gets ready for work. Takes a cassette in his bag.

His daughter runs out in school uniform. He picks up his lunch bag, kisses her wife in lips and sits down and kisses her sightly bulged stomach and keeps his ear on it.

Gets on his TVS scooter, drops his daughter in school. Goes to a cassette shop, gives it and gets another one. Drives long for about an hour, stops at a point.

He opens a gate. He looks at the plants arranged in order and smiles at them. As he goes in wipes the dust in the name board which says "Infinite Green nursery".

He breathes in, walks inside greeting at the plants with a good morning.

He takes the cassette from his bag, shows it to them and tells that he's got a new song today.

He walks to the room made up of plastic green sheet. The room looks small with plastic spots, packets of fertilizers. His dad's photo.

A certificate is framed saying "Green Thumb Award", switches power ON. There are speakers all over the garden. He presses a switch from the radio, a compartment opens up. He puts the cassette in. Closes it and presses play.

Speakers crackles and a voice shouts "everybody". . It is a song from backstreet boys.

As the song plays, he picks up the dead fallen leaves and puts in a plastic box saying "for fertilisers", singing along with the song, picks up the flowers from each plant into a basket and keeps the first one in front of his father's photo.

Waters all the plants one by one with care, spraying for some of the indoor plants, puts fertilisers for some.

Another song plays. Customers starts to come in. He welcomes them with smile and shows all around explaining the plants and its origin and what to do and what not to do.

By afternoon, he opens his bag, sits facing them all and starts to speaking.

He tells, that in a a few months there will be a new guest in their house. He likes it to be boy but his wife needs a girl again. But whomever he will love them both.

He laughs, telling all the gossips that they shared at his colony.

He suddenly jumps and says, alia got second prize for singing. He feels proud, saying like dad, like daughter.

He stops for a second like something caught in his throat. He drinks water from the bottle.

Keeping the food down back in box.

He looks at them and says, he once dreamed of being a musician. He played guitar in his college got prize for it. He even used to sing and attract girls with his talent.

Played for some musicians for short films, stage performances. Once his dad died of hear attack, he was pushed to take way his dad's business leaving his dreams.

He stays silent for a minute. A small breeze flows and touches him. He wipes his tears and says, still he is happy being here with them.

He asks, if they wanted to hear the song that he wrote. There was silence with a breeze making the leaves to move falling on him.

He smiles and walks inside, brings a dusty guitar. Sits on a chair at the centre of all.

He starts to play with his fingers over the strings of the guitar, singing a song. He looks at them all as if they are his audience. Sometimes he would feel the breeze heavier, he would feel like they are enjoying it more. Ne never felt this happiness before.

It goes on and on and on. . The song carrying away by the breeze moving towards the leaves of the plants, moving them to feel like they are dancing to it.

It carried towards the evening. He looks at his watch, gets up telling them he has to pick up his daughter from school.

He takes the cassette, takes the flower with him. Closes the door. Before closing the gate he says, it was nice playing here and will be back with new cassette and new song from him.

The leaves waves their hand at him when breeze flows.
